Mai is a Rural village located in Rafiganj, Aurangabad, Bihar.

The total population of Mai is 2,266.

Mai village comprises 340 households.

The literacy rate in Mai is 57.4%. Among the literate population of 1,022, there are 665 literate males and 357 literate females.

In Mai, there are 1,201 males and 1,065 females, with a sex ratio of 887 females per 1000 males.

There are 484 children (21.4% of population), comprising 260 boys and 224 girls.

The total number of workers in Mai is 655, with 363 main workers and 292 marginal workers.

In Mai, there are 713 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(371 males, 342 females) and 1 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(1 males, 0 females).

Mai is located in Bihar state, Aurangabad district, and falls under Rafiganj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 253164 and LGD code is 253164.
